Amazon has 40mm Seiko Men's Japanese Mechanical Automatic Stainless Steel Watch w/ Black Dial (SZSB014) on sale for $241.31. Shipping is free.

Thanks to community member bluzcluz for posting this deal.

Note: Select accounts may be see a 15% off coupon on the product page.

About this item:
  • Seiko's 4R35 mechanical movement beats at a frequency of 21,600 vibrations per hour with manual and automatic winding capabilities and a power reserve of 41 hours
  • Case Diameter: 39.9mm
  • Minimalist black dial with sunray finish, gold accents, and date calendar
  • Stainless steel case and bracelet with tri-fold push button release clasp
  • Water-resistant to 10 bar, 100 meters (330 feet)

Quote from craig.678 :
Is $240 a lot to you?
It's mostly about the competition. For $240 I could pick up an Orient Mako III with sapphire crystal and a slightly better movement, or spend a bit more and move up to the $300-500 range (where there's a diverse selection of JDM models). Hardlex scratches fairly easily and is a pain to polish so I generally avoid it.

Quote from FuschiaStag280 :
Do you think it would be worth buying this and replacing the hardlex with sapphire? How much would that cost?
You can get a sapphire crystal for $20-80 (depending on quality), and a cheap crystal press for another $50. If you have a local watchmaker or repair shop nearby you can probably get them to do the replacement for you instead at a lower cost. It's up to you whether it's worth it or not.
